Albert Pyun is a prolific American film director known for his work in the action, sci-fi, and thriller genres. With a career spanning over four decades, Pyun has left an indelible mark on cinema with his unique vision and directorial style. His most notable film, "Cyborg" (1989), has solidified his status as a cult favorite in the sci-fi and action film community.
